国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

程序設(shè)計(jì)課程小班試點(diǎn)

2015-12-29 00:00:00戴波周世杰陳文字盧光輝丘志杰黃酈生
計(jì)算機(jī)教育 2015年7期

文章編號:1672-5913(2015)07-0099-03

中圖分類號:G642

摘要:針對程序設(shè)計(jì)課程存在的理論與編程實(shí)踐學(xué)時(shí)安排矛盾以及實(shí)驗(yàn)教學(xué)中師生配比不夠、實(shí)驗(yàn)輔導(dǎo)不足等問題,提出加強(qiáng)預(yù)習(xí)干預(yù)引導(dǎo)、實(shí)戰(zhàn)演練、課堂教師輔導(dǎo)和實(shí)驗(yàn)指導(dǎo)以及增加學(xué)生分組互助學(xué)習(xí)、學(xué)生討論、成果演示等手段,結(jié)合目前國內(nèi)外取得良好教學(xué)效果的翻轉(zhuǎn)課堂教學(xué)法、微課視頻資源實(shí)現(xiàn)翻轉(zhuǎn)教學(xué),并擬在小班試點(diǎn)改進(jìn)后推廣。

關(guān)鍵詞:程序設(shè)計(jì)課程;翻轉(zhuǎn)課堂;微課視頻;小班教學(xué)

0 引 言

為了全面貫徹落實(shí)《教育部關(guān)于全面提高高等教育質(zhì)量的若干意見》(教高[2012]4號)精神,不斷深化本科人才培養(yǎng)模式改革,構(gòu)建研究型大學(xué)本科人才培養(yǎng)新體系,培養(yǎng)高素質(zhì)拔尖創(chuàng)新人才,《電子科技大學(xué)本科人才培養(yǎng)方案修訂指導(dǎo)意見》以通識課程、學(xué)科基礎(chǔ)課程、學(xué)科拓展課程、專業(yè)核心課程、實(shí)踐類核心課程、個(gè)性化課程6個(gè)課程模塊的構(gòu)建為核心,推動課程的整合和優(yōu)化,搭建個(gè)性化、多元化的人才培養(yǎng)平臺,促進(jìn)學(xué)生全面、個(gè)性發(fā)展,其理工類課程模塊與學(xué)時(shí)要求如圖1所示。

基于學(xué)校的培養(yǎng)理念,計(jì)算機(jī)科學(xué)與工程學(xué)院將培養(yǎng)目標(biāo)定位在培養(yǎng)掌握計(jì)算機(jī)基本理論和基本知識,接受從事研究與應(yīng)用計(jì)算機(jī)的基本訓(xùn)練,具有研究和開發(fā)計(jì)算機(jī)軟、硬件基本能力的高級人才。程序設(shè)計(jì)課程是計(jì)算機(jī)專業(yè)的核心基礎(chǔ),涉及程序設(shè)計(jì)語言(C語言)、數(shù)據(jù)結(jié)構(gòu)、算法設(shè)計(jì)與分析、面向?qū)ο笳Z言(C++/C#/Java)、設(shè)計(jì)模式和軟件工程等多門課程。我們分析當(dāng)前教學(xué)中存在的如課程分割零碎、課程之間連貫性差、不同課程內(nèi)容重復(fù)較多、對后續(xù)課程支撐力度不大、教學(xué)手段落后與師資隊(duì)伍建設(shè)不足等問題,在課程、實(shí)驗(yàn)和團(tuán)隊(duì)建設(shè)等方面做了一系列研究探索,如采用遞增式的項(xiàng)目驅(qū)動教學(xué)分級培訓(xùn)學(xué)生程序設(shè)計(jì)技能,組建程序設(shè)計(jì)基礎(chǔ)團(tuán)隊(duì),重新設(shè)計(jì)與整合關(guān)聯(lián)課程,采用自動化批改程序軟件,建立題庫與項(xiàng)目庫等方案,并在小班連續(xù)2年進(jìn)行試點(diǎn),取得良好效果,2014年開始在全年級推廣。

1 推廣后的程序設(shè)計(jì)課程現(xiàn)狀與調(diào)查分析

1.1 推廣后的程序設(shè)計(jì)課程現(xiàn)狀

小班試點(diǎn)在舊有培養(yǎng)方案的基礎(chǔ)上進(jìn)行,C語言和C++課程內(nèi)容有整合,但仍然與其他班級一樣分開教學(xué)和參加統(tǒng)一的期末考試,便于與其他班級對比教學(xué)效果。2014年,我們基于新的培養(yǎng)方案在全年級進(jìn)行合并后的程序設(shè)計(jì)語言教學(xué),同時(shí)面臨如下現(xiàn)狀。

(1)內(nèi)容多,時(shí)間緊,以前的兩門課程合并成為一門課程之后,課時(shí)數(shù)量是以前一門課程的課時(shí)數(shù)量,而不是兩門課程課時(shí)數(shù)量的總和。

(2)導(dǎo)論課沒有打下基礎(chǔ),如對于計(jì)算機(jī)硬件及工作流程的初步認(rèn)識、內(nèi)存管理方式的理解、鼠標(biāo)鍵盤的熟悉、操作系統(tǒng)和辦公軟件的熟悉與使用等。

(3)課程合并后,兩門課程的教師總數(shù)增加,班級人數(shù)由120人以上/班減少為70人/班,達(dá)不到學(xué)校120人/班配置助教的條件,沒有助教,作業(yè)批改量大,上機(jī)輔導(dǎo)忙不過來,上機(jī)考試監(jiān)考教師人數(shù)不夠。實(shí)踐證明,每次實(shí)驗(yàn)課教師能夠輔導(dǎo)到的學(xué)生人數(shù)不超過10人。

1.2 推廣后的程序設(shè)計(jì)課程調(diào)查

課程結(jié)束后,7個(gè)班的7名教師和480名學(xué)生分別發(fā)放調(diào)查問卷,其中回收的有效反饋調(diào)查表為教師7份,學(xué)生186份。

1)教師調(diào)查反饋。

(1)合并后教學(xué)時(shí)間緊,學(xué)生掌握所有內(nèi)容有難度,存在部分學(xué)生學(xué)習(xí)積極性不高,如上課玩手機(jī)和到課率不高等情況。

(2)每班上機(jī)相關(guān)練習(xí)題、實(shí)驗(yàn)、綜合實(shí)驗(yàn)均超過20題,有的班級達(dá)到50道題以上。上機(jī)題目兼具應(yīng)用性和趣味性。

(3)導(dǎo)師輔導(dǎo)的上機(jī)訓(xùn)練題量大。

(4)基礎(chǔ)類型的實(shí)驗(yàn)和練習(xí)題完成情況良好,綜合性的實(shí)驗(yàn)和練習(xí)題只有部分學(xué)生能夠完成。

2)學(xué)生調(diào)查反饋。

(1)有編程基礎(chǔ)的學(xué)生在高中階段學(xué)習(xí)過的編程語言種類有8種,66%的學(xué)生學(xué)習(xí)過C/C++,普遍表現(xiàn)出對目前教學(xué)狀況非常滿意,在教師指導(dǎo)下比高中學(xué)習(xí)得更深入,能夠?qū)W習(xí)到很多原理性的東西;同時(shí)也表示希望能夠給予更多的課后學(xué)習(xí)指導(dǎo),提供工程訓(xùn)練機(jī)會。有編程基礎(chǔ)的部分學(xué)生仍然感覺上課速度快。

(2)沒有編程基礎(chǔ)的學(xué)生認(rèn)為目前教學(xué)難度合適的達(dá)73%,較難/難的達(dá)22%,簡單的達(dá)5%:普遍希望教師講解得更細(xì)致,課堂上能夠演示編程過程,再多增加上機(jī)輔導(dǎo)、上機(jī)作業(yè)和練習(xí)題,能夠有項(xiàng)目實(shí)踐機(jī)會。

1.3 推廣后的期末考試情況與教師試卷分析總結(jié)

推廣后的期末考試分?jǐn)?shù)對比見表1。

表1的平均比例表明不及格率占比最高,接近1/3,90分以上占比最低,不到10%;同時(shí)表明不同班級差別比較大,教師的教學(xué)經(jīng)驗(yàn)對于學(xué)習(xí)效果很重要,如教師l有多年C語言和C++語言教學(xué)經(jīng)驗(yàn),其余的教師只從事C語言或者C++語言教學(xué),因此雖然使用同樣的教材,但是由于教學(xué)經(jīng)驗(yàn)、教學(xué)手段、學(xué)生不同,使得學(xué)生掌握情況不同。教師6強(qiáng)調(diào)大學(xué)階段的學(xué)習(xí)自覺性,對學(xué)生管束比較少,教學(xué)方式比較靈活,最終考試效果最差,不及格率達(dá)到44.8%,說明學(xué)生學(xué)習(xí)自覺性差,教師的恰當(dāng)約束對于當(dāng)前環(huán)境下的學(xué)生學(xué)習(xí)非常有必要。

7位教師總結(jié)學(xué)生的失分點(diǎn)基本一致,主要集中在填空題的細(xì)節(jié)問題、讀程序、寫程序和判斷題,恰好是編程訓(xùn)練沒有過關(guān)的體現(xiàn),這也和各位教師根據(jù)考試情況的反思總結(jié)一致。教師都反映需要加強(qiáng)編程練習(xí)、上機(jī)輔導(dǎo)、課上程序演示、程序設(shè)計(jì)思維訓(xùn)練,但又都覺得編程練習(xí)已經(jīng)很多,上機(jī)量也很大,但訓(xùn)練效果卻不明顯。以冒泡排序?yàn)槔?,教師上課講,中期考核,期末復(fù)習(xí),但是該內(nèi)容在期末考試中仍然是大的失分點(diǎn)且全年級都呈現(xiàn)這樣的現(xiàn)象,這說明在學(xué)習(xí)過程中有的學(xué)生不認(rèn)真做,有的學(xué)生做了但沒有真正理解和掌握算法原理、編程基礎(chǔ)、調(diào)試技術(shù)。

教師反思其中一個(gè)大的矛盾是理論教學(xué)與實(shí)踐教學(xué)的學(xué)時(shí)需求矛盾:①不講或者簡單講解基礎(chǔ)理論及細(xì)節(jié),學(xué)生只能依葫蘆畫瓢而無法舉一反三,理論基礎(chǔ)不穩(wěn)固則技術(shù)不深人,有程序設(shè)計(jì)基礎(chǔ)的學(xué)生則不能進(jìn)行深入學(xué)習(xí);②詳細(xì)深入講解需要花費(fèi)大量時(shí)間;③無編程基礎(chǔ)的學(xué)生對理論學(xué)習(xí)普遍不感興趣且由于缺乏經(jīng)驗(yàn),對教師講解的理論理解不夠深入,教師在課堂上沒有時(shí)間進(jìn)行反復(fù)講解,而學(xué)生不得不在應(yīng)用過程中根據(jù)需要反復(fù)學(xué)習(xí)這些基礎(chǔ)知識。

為解決這些矛盾,各個(gè)教師根據(jù)教學(xué)經(jīng)驗(yàn)各有取舍,其中教師5與教師7是以實(shí)踐為主與理論講授為主比較突出的2個(gè)代表。教師5采用以上機(jī)實(shí)驗(yàn)為主、理論教授為輔的教學(xué)方式,設(shè)計(jì)上機(jī)相關(guān)題目超過50題且上機(jī)演示編程過程,編程輔導(dǎo)時(shí)間多,同時(shí)另外找了優(yōu)秀學(xué)生一起對學(xué)生進(jìn)行上機(jī)輔導(dǎo),但期末筆試90分以上的占比9.2%,不及格率為27.7%。教師7以理論講授為主,對于上機(jī)實(shí)驗(yàn)輔導(dǎo)嚴(yán)格按照培養(yǎng)方案的16學(xué)時(shí),期末筆試考試成績表明學(xué)生上機(jī)實(shí)驗(yàn)過少,理論掌握并不扎實(shí),90分以上的占比為0.00%,不及格率仍然達(dá)到23.1%。以上情況說明“單腳大跨步”的教學(xué)方式效果欠佳,但兩者結(jié)合教學(xué)又存在學(xué)時(shí)數(shù)不夠的現(xiàn)實(shí)問題,此外還存在如下問題:學(xué)生認(rèn)為最難的不是理論學(xué)習(xí),而是將理論應(yīng)用于實(shí)際;不少學(xué)生需要督促,自覺性差,而教師只有一人,怎么辦?

2 改進(jìn)措施

針對程序設(shè)計(jì)課程在全年級推廣后出現(xiàn)的問題,程序設(shè)計(jì)教學(xué)團(tuán)隊(duì)教師積極思考、討論并試圖尋找能夠解決現(xiàn)存問題的教學(xué)方法。戴爾的經(jīng)驗(yàn)之塔說明單純的課堂教學(xué)平均只能夠達(dá)到20%的效果,而具有主動學(xué)習(xí)的參與、討論、演講等教學(xué)方法可以達(dá)到50%-90%的教學(xué)效果。既要在有限的時(shí)間內(nèi)傳授基礎(chǔ)理論,深入講解原理和運(yùn)行機(jī)制且可以在實(shí)踐過程中能夠隨時(shí)查閱學(xué)習(xí)基礎(chǔ)理論,又要在教師人數(shù)有限的條件下給予足夠的上機(jī)實(shí)驗(yàn)演示和輔導(dǎo),教師就需要將一些以記憶和理解為主的知識點(diǎn)放到課前讓學(xué)生預(yù)習(xí),課堂上以項(xiàng)目驅(qū)動的方式引導(dǎo)學(xué)生加強(qiáng)編程練習(xí)并給予輔導(dǎo)。此外,對于一些需要深入分析的問題則可在學(xué)生預(yù)習(xí)的情況下,在課堂上以分組或者集體討論的方式解決,但存在部分學(xué)生不預(yù)習(xí)而等待教師上課講解或者學(xué)生預(yù)習(xí)目的性不強(qiáng)、自學(xué)能力不夠等問題。教學(xué)團(tuán)隊(duì)教師經(jīng)過調(diào)研發(fā)現(xiàn),最近幾年在國內(nèi)外逐步發(fā)展的翻轉(zhuǎn)課堂教學(xué)恰好滿足有教學(xué)理論研究支撐和國內(nèi)外優(yōu)秀教學(xué)經(jīng)驗(yàn)借鑒等條件,具體方案如下。

(1)將理論知識的講解以微課的形式錄制成視頻,達(dá)到學(xué)生在教師引導(dǎo)條件下自學(xué)的效果,同時(shí)在學(xué)生完成預(yù)習(xí)作業(yè)后,檢驗(yàn)其學(xué)習(xí)效果以便于學(xué)生根據(jù)自身情況決定是否還需要反復(fù)看視頻鞏固學(xué)習(xí);教師也可以通過學(xué)生完成預(yù)習(xí)作業(yè)的情況制訂課堂活動安排,協(xié)助學(xué)生更好地掌握知識。

(2)教師將分析問題、設(shè)計(jì)思路、流程圖繪制、編程、編譯鏈接、調(diào)試等演示案例的完整過程錄制成視頻,讓學(xué)生可以反復(fù)觀看臨摹,解決初期沒有教師在身邊編程入門難的問題,達(dá)到課堂演示編程的效果,避免課堂上編程占用時(shí)間過多、編程代碼文字過小后排學(xué)生看不清楚等問題。

(3)在課堂上指導(dǎo)學(xué)生進(jìn)行編程練習(xí),解決學(xué)生視頻學(xué)習(xí)過程中的疑問、討論解決實(shí)際項(xiàng)目問題的方法及方案的選擇。

(4)鼓勵(lì)優(yōu)秀學(xué)生幫助其他同學(xué),對于幫助其他同學(xué)的學(xué)生給予平時(shí)成績加分,解決缺乏編程輔導(dǎo)的問題。

(5)在現(xiàn)有培養(yǎng)方案條件下擬用部分班級試點(diǎn)進(jìn)行翻轉(zhuǎn)教學(xué),部分班級不采用,然后進(jìn)行效果對比和進(jìn)一步分析與改進(jìn),使其更適合當(dāng)前的本科教學(xué)。

3 結(jié)語

基于“全面發(fā)展的創(chuàng)新教育”人才培養(yǎng)理念培養(yǎng)高素質(zhì)拔尖創(chuàng)新人才,除了構(gòu)建合理的人才培養(yǎng)體系外,還需改進(jìn)對學(xué)生培養(yǎng)更直觀有效的課程教學(xué)。翻轉(zhuǎn)課堂教學(xué)以實(shí)踐理論“戴爾的經(jīng)驗(yàn)之塔”和布魯姆認(rèn)知教育目標(biāo)分類模型理論為基礎(chǔ),強(qiáng)調(diào)學(xué)生在教師的指導(dǎo)下學(xué)習(xí),學(xué)生是教育的主體,教師的教是為了不教,自主學(xué)習(xí)具有無可替代的價(jià)值。翻轉(zhuǎn)課堂教學(xué)法以學(xué)生為主體進(jìn)行研究,能夠在有限的教學(xué)時(shí)間內(nèi)達(dá)到傳授知識、教授技能、培養(yǎng)自學(xué)能力的目的,可操作性強(qiáng),是解決現(xiàn)有程序設(shè)計(jì)課程改革問題的有效方法,但效果和存在的問題還有待多次試點(diǎn)改進(jìn)及全面推廣后具體分析及解決。

莆田市| 慈溪市| 东港市| 宁津县| 哈尔滨市| 德惠市| 景德镇市| 武义县| 长治县| 米易县| 阿拉善右旗| 榕江县| 精河县| 襄城县| 蓬溪县| 青铜峡市| 四子王旗| 高要市| 丰都县| 台山市| 沅陵县| 泰和县| 扬州市| 九江市| 五河县| 盘锦市| 吴旗县| 南阳市| 深泽县| 团风县| 买车| 类乌齐县| 永修县| 从江县| 黄骅市| 南木林县| 淄博市| 江川县| 镇坪县| 哈密市| 永昌县|